|
Oracle Fusion Middleware extensions for Applications Core API Reference 11g Release 1 (11.1.1.6) E22562-03 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object oracle.apps.fnd.applcore.flex.runtime.util.common.ValueSetUsage oracle.apps.fnd.applcore.flex.runtime.util.common.CustomValueSetUsage
public class CustomValueSetUsage
The usage of a custom value set.
Constructor Summary | |
---|---|
CustomValueSetUsage(CustomValueSetDef cvsd,
boolean isNullAllowed)
Constructs a usage of a custom value set. |
Method Summary | |
---|---|
SegmentDef |
getReferenceSegment(CustomValueSetDef.BindVariable bindVar)
Gets the reference segment a bind variable is bound to. |
protected void |
setReferenceSegment(CustomValueSetDef.BindVariable bindVar,
SegmentDef seg)
Sets the reference segment a bind variable is bound to. |
Methods inherited from class oracle.apps.fnd.applcore.flex.runtime.util.common.ValueSetUsage |
---|
getExtraValidationRules, getReferenceSegment, getValueSetDef, isNullAllowed, setExtraValidationRules, setNullAllowed, setReferenceSegment |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public CustomValueSetUsage(CustomValueSetDef cvsd, boolean isNullAllowed)
cvsd
- the definition of a custom value setisNullAllowed
- true if null value is allowedMethod Detail |
---|
protected void setReferenceSegment(CustomValueSetDef.BindVariable bindVar, SegmentDef seg)
bindVar
- the bind variableseg
- the reference segment the bind variable is bound to
java.lang.IllegalArgumentException
- if the given bind variable type is
not SEGMENT or VALUESET
java.lang.NullPointerException
- if the given bind variable is nullpublic SegmentDef getReferenceSegment(CustomValueSetDef.BindVariable bindVar)
bindVar
- the bind variable
java.lang.NullPointerException
- if the given bind variable is null
|
Oracle Fusion Middleware extensions for Applications Core API Reference 11g Release 1 (11.1.1.6) E22562-03 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|